With its Tuscan campanile-like tower, Fürth's town hall gives the impression of being in Italy for a moment. And that's no accident. Its architect, Friedrich Bürklein, was directly inspired by the Palazzo Vecchio in Florence. Even today, the Rathaus bears witness to the city's 19th-century boom, and to the municipality's desire to give the city a representative building. A special feature of the Town Hall: every day at 12.04 p.m., the campanile bells play Led Zeppelin's Stairway to Heaven.
